Export (0) Print
Expand All

2.2.1.6.4 NL_GENERIC_RPC_DATA

The NL_GENERIC_RPC_DATA structure defines a format for marshaling arrays of unsigned long values and Unicode strings, by value, over RPC.<64> The NL_GENERIC_RPC_DATA structure can be used to transmit generic data over RPC from the server to a client.

typedef struct _NL_GENERIC_RPC_DATA {
  unsigned long UlongEntryCount;
  [size_is(UlongEntryCount)] unsigned long* UlongData;
  unsigned long UnicodeStringEntryCount;
  [size_is(UnicodeStringEntryCount)] 
    PRPC_UNICODE_STRING UnicodeStringData;
} NL_GENERIC_RPC_DATA, 
 *PNL_GENERIC_RPC_DATA;

UlongEntryCount: The number of entries in UlongData.

UlongData: A pointer to an array of unsigned 32-bit integer values.

UnicodeStringEntryCount: The number of entries in UnicodeStringData.

UnicodeStringData: A pointer to an array of Unicode string structures.

 
Show:
© 2014 Microsoft